Residence
Samuel P. Crider was listed as the head of household on the 1900 Kansas City, Missouri census. Listed in the household were wife Nannie E, daughters Leota and Bessie.Residence
Samuel P. Crider was listed as the head of household on the 1910 census. According to the census, Samuel was 49 years old and born in Illinois. Samuel and his wife, Nannie had been married 22 years. Also listed in his household were daughters, Leota P. age 20 and Bess T, age 18.Endnotes
